Run state 1 is limited because the processes that support login through devices other than the console, log system messages, run cron jobs, mount remote file systems, and provide the bulk of the usual Unix environment are simply not running In single-user mode, you will, obviously, have some local file systems mounted and be able to log in as root on the system console Naming support and network information services, such as DNS and NIS, will not be available This run state is used for system repair and troubleshooting (eg, checking file systems) In run state 2, on the other hand, most processes are running, but file systems are not shared (exported) Users with homes on the system will find they cannot access them There is nothing peculiar about run states They have nothing to do with the state of the CPU or even the kernel.

The only real difference between one run state and another is, once again, what processes are running It is not until we get to run state 2 that we begin to see the familiar environment we have come to identify as Unix Configuring run states is simply a matter of selecting which processes are to start and stop when that run state is entered and then setting up the proper scripts to make this happen More precisely, it is a matter of selecting which processes stop and start We will explain this distinction shortly..

If you notice any CPU ratings that seem unusually high for the type of application in question, that specific item might be the cause of your computer experiencing performance problems Similarly, the Disk section shows the total hard disk In/Out transfer rate (disk reads and writes in kilobytes per second) Click the down mark to see which files are using the disk Again, if you see any system attributes in this case, the Read, Write or Response Time categories that are out of the ordinary, you might be able to pinpoint which program is creating problems for your PC The Network section shows the total network data transfer rate in megabits per second Expanding the section shows the remote computers involved in the current transfers.

If there is an individual computer that has a larger Send, Receive, or Total calculation than the other systems connected to the network, this particular machine might be responsible for generating the backlog in the network The Memory section shows the average number of hard memory faults per second and the percentage of memory in use by the total system Expanding the section shows each process in memory as well as the hard faults and memory used by each Hard faults are not memory faults per se; rather, they report only that the process had to access the hard disk to find data when it could not find them in memory.

When a program has an exceptionally high Working (or Private) rate, it is most likely the source responsible for consuming a vast amount of your computer s available memory; thus, it might potentially be causing your PC s performance problems The Learn More section provides links to Help files for each of the Reliability and Performance monitoring tools In the left pane of the Reliability and Performance Monitor window is a navigational tree that offers three different diagnostic methods: Monitoring Tools, Data Collector Sets, and Reports Clicking Monitoring Tools brings up two more functions: Performance Monitor and Reliability Monitor Both items are explained in further detail in the following sections, as are the Data Collector Sets and Reports..

If you are making a long animation that covers a long period of time, say more than 30 seconds, the key points may be close together and difficult to distinguish from one another. You can use the zoom tools in the lower-right corner of the timeline area to zoom the timeline in or out. Zooming in makes the key points appear further away from one another, allowing you to select one that might be right on top of another. Other mistakes or animation problems will also come up, such as parts that don t move correctly. In most of these situations, the fastest way to deal with them is to delete the problem key points and recreate them. Troubleshooting some errors tends to be fruitless and takes longer than re-creation.
